Description
The STM32F030R8T6TR is a microcontroller from STMicroelectronics, part of the STM32 family, which is based on the ARM Cortex-M0 core. It is designed for embedded applications that require low power consumption and cost-effectiveness. The STM32F030R8T6TR features a 32-bit RISC processor running up to 48 MHz, and includes 64 KB of Flash memory and 8 KB of SRAM, aiding in efficient code execution and data handling.
The microcontroller supports a wide range of peripherals, including USART, SPI, I2C, and ADC, making it versatile for various communication and sensor-interfacing tasks. It also includes advanced control timers and a comprehensive set of power-saving modes, making it suitable for battery-powered devices. The package is available in LQFP-64, which offers a balanced approach for size and pin availability.
Its affordability and robust feature set make the STM32F030R8T6TR ideal for consumer electronics, industrial control, and other applications requiring efficient processing and connectivity.

Features
The STM32F030R8T6TR is a microcontroller from STMicroelectronics based on the ARM Cortex-M0 core. Key features include:
1. Core and Performance: ARM Cortex-M0 running at up to 48 MHz.
2. Memory: 64 KB Flash memory and 8 KB SRAM.
3. Package: LQFP-64 package with 64 pins.
4. I/O Ports: 51 I/O pins with multiple functions.
5. Timers: Includes one 16-bit advanced-control timer, one 32-bit and three 16-bit general-purpose timers, and a 16-bit basic timer.
6. Communication Interfaces:
- USARTs: Up to 6
- I2C: Up to 2
- SPIs: Up to 2
- I2S: Supported via SPI2
7. Analog Features:
- One 12-bit ADC with up to 16 channels
- Temperature sensor
- Comparators
8. Operating Voltage: 2.4V to 3.6V.
9. Development: Supported by STM32 development tools and software.
10. Operating Temperature: -40°C to +85°C.
The STM32F030R8T6TR is targeted at cost-sensitive applications, providing a balance of performance and power consumption for embedded devices.

Package
The STM32F030R8T6TR is packaged in an LQFP-64 (Low-Profile Quad Flat Pack with 64 pins). This package type is used for microcontrollers and provides a compact footprint suitable for surface-mount technology (SMT).
